§ 45A.258 — RECONSIDERATION OF SATISFACTION OF FINES OR COSTS

View on source(a)If the defendant notifies the justice or judge that the defendant has difficulty paying the fine and costs in compliance with the judgment, the justice or judge shall hold a hearing to determine whether the judgment imposes an undue hardship on the defendant.
(b)For purposes of Subsection (a), a defendant may notify the justice or judge by:
(1)voluntarily appearing and informing the justice or judge or the clerk of the court in the manner established by the justice or judge for that purpose;
(2)filing a motion with the justice or judge;
(3)mailing a letter to the justice or judge; or
(4)any other method established by the justice or judge for that purpose.
